英英释义

  • v.

    1.to spin quickly in circles

    2.to turn quickly, usually to look at someone or something

    3.if your mind, thoughts, or feelings whirl, you feel very confused or upset

  • n.

    1.a lot of confused activity and movement

    2.a spinning movement
